We’re comparing great hotel deals for you...

    Hôtel de la Poste (Le Mêle-sur-Sarthe, France)

    Hôtel de la Poste (Le Mêle-sur-Sarthe, France)

    About Hôtel de la Poste

    Top amenities

      All amenities

      Property amenities
      1. Non-smoking rooms
      2. Free WiFi
      Room amenities
      1. Central heating
      2. Cable TV

      Contact

      Place du General de Gaulle 31,  Le Mêle-sur-Sarthe,  France

      Frequently Asked Questions about Hôtel de la Poste

      Destinations nearby Hôtel de la Poste

      Other destinations close to Hôtel de la Poste

      Explore nearby attractions